Background
The mobile phone signal shielding device mainly aims at places where mobile phones are forbidden, such as various examination rooms, schools, gas stations, churches, courtrooms, libraries, conference centers (rooms), movie theaters, hospitals, governments, finance, prisons, public security, military places and the like, the mobile phone signal shielding device in the market can limit mobile phone signals beyond 500M meters of a transmitting station, the shielding radius is adjustable, the coverage range reaches more than 30 square meters, and the mobile phone signal shielding device can only shield the mobile phone signals and does not affect other electronic equipment. The power is saved, the power is 12W-480W, and the device is also called a signal interference device.
The conventional signal jammer may bump during transportation, which may cause internal electronic components to become loose, thereby affecting the service life of the signal jammer, and therefore a signal jammer protection device for communication is needed to solve the above problems.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, rather than all embodiments, and in the present invention, unless explicitly specified or limited otherwise, the terms "mounting", "setting", "connecting", "fixing", "screwing", and the like are to be understood in a broad sense, for example, they may be fixedly connected, detachably connected, or integrated; can be mechanically or electrically connected; they may be directly connected or indirectly connected through an intermediate medium, and may be connected through the inside of two elements or in an interaction relationship between two elements, unless otherwise specifically defined, and the specific meaning of the above terms in the present invention will be understood by those skilled in the art according to specific situations.
Example 1
Referring to fig. 1-2, a signal interference ware protector for communication, including protective housing 2, protective housing 2 both sides inner wall bottom rotates and is connected with same two- way lead screw 6, and 6 circumference outer wall both sides of two-way lead screw all rotate and are connected with fixed block 11, the sliding tray has been seted up to fixed block 11 top outer wall, and sliding tray inner wall sliding connection has sliding block 12, same fixed plate 8 is installed to one side outer wall that two sliding blocks 12 are relative, same signal interference ware body 13 has been placed to two fixed plate 8 top outer walls, magnetic block ring 10 is installed to signal interference ware body 13 bottom outer wall.
The utility model discloses in, buffer spring 9 is installed to sliding block 12 bottom outer wall, and buffer spring 9 bottom outer wall and sliding tray bottom inner wall fixed connection, 6 one side of two-way lead screw extend to protective housing 2's outside, and 6 one side outer walls of two-way lead screw install circular block 1, 2 top outer walls of protective housing one side articulate there is apron 3, and 3 top outer walls of apron one side install handle 5, the rectangular channel has been seted up to 3 top outer walls of apron, and the rectangular channel both sides inner wall installs same iron mesh board 4, the mounting groove has been seted up to 2 bottom outer walls of protective housing, and the same radiator fan 7 is installed to mounting groove both sides inner wall.
The working principle is as follows: the signal interference device body 13 can be fixed by arranging the round block 1, the bidirectional screw rod 6, the fixed block 11 and the fixed plate 8 on the sliding block 12, the shaking generated when the signal interference device body 13 is moved is avoided, the buffer spring 13 arranged at the bottom of the sliding block 12 can buffer and damp the signal interference device body 13, thereby improving the stability of movement, when the device is moved to a working place, the cover plate 3 is opened, the signal interference device body 13 is taken out and put on the cover plate 3 for working, the magnetic block ring 10 arranged at the bottom of the signal interference device body 13 and the iron mesh plate 4 arranged on the cover plate 3 can firmly fix the signal interference device body 13, ensure the working stability, through being provided with radiator fan 7, can dispel the heat to the signal interference ware body 13 in the work, guaranteed that signal interference ware body 13 can normally work for a long time.
Example 2
Referring to fig. 1-3, the protection device for the signal interference unit for communication further comprises a fixing frame 14 mounted on the outer wall of the bottom of the protection housing 2, and the same dust removing screen 15 is mounted on the inner walls of two sides of the fixing frame 14.
The working principle is as follows: compared with the embodiment 1, the heat radiation fan 7 can be protected by the fixing frame 14 and the dustproof screen plate 15 arranged below the protection shell 2, the air can be dedusted, and dust is prevented from accumulating inside the protection shell 2, so that the device is more perfect.
